Fun facts about El Pollo Loco Holdings, Inc.

Quirks, history, and lore behind LOCO — the kind of stuff that makes a stock memorable.

  • 1
    The Basics
    U.S. quick-service restaurant company · small-cap · listed on Nasdaq · headquartered in Southern California.
  • 2
    The Numbers
    Operates and franchises roughly 500 locations, nearly all in the western United States, with annual system sales in the hundreds of millions of dollars.
  • 3
    The History
    The chain was founded in 1980 in Los Angeles and went public in 2014, bringing a regional cult favorite to Wall Street for the first time.
  • 4
    The Secret
    It occupies a deliberate niche between fast food and fast casual — sometimes called 'Mexified chicken' — leaning hard on citrus-marinated proteins to stand out.
  • 5
    The Lore
    The brand built its identity around flame-grilled chicken long before 'grilled' was a health buzzword, and its loyal fanbase in California and Texas treats it more like a local institution than a chain.
  • 6
    The Giveaway
    The name literally means 'The Crazy Chicken' in Spanish — and yes, that's also the Nasdaq ticker: pure poultry, proudly unhinged.

AI Insight: LOCO Ratio Trends

LOCO operating margins recovered to 9.7% in Q2 2026 after dipping to 7.5% in Q1 2025, while leverage steadily declined from 0.35x to 0.15x.

Operating margin improved from 7.5% in Q1 2025 to 9.7% in Q2 2026, recovering most ground lost.

Debt-to-equity ratio declined consistently from 0.35x in Q2 2024 to 0.15x in Q2 2026.

ROIC fluctuated between 10.6% and 14.7% but recovered to 14.1% in latest quarter.

Net profit margin reached 6.5% in Q2 2026, the highest level across the data period.

Operating margin volatility with 190bp swing from Q1 2025 trough to Q2 2026 peak.

Sequential margin decline in Q4 2025 to 8.3% suggests potential seasonal headwinds.
